The Complete Campus Campaign Collection (Volumes 1-4)

This comprehensive collection consists of Volumes 1, 2, 3 and the newest collection Volume 4, totaling 360 hours of original Pacifica programming. The collection includes episodes of From the Vault, Pacifica Radio Archives' radio series exploring a wide range of American history through painstakingly restored audio recordings dating back to the dawn of community radio broadcasting in 1949.
